Actually the point of this first BOM is NOT to provide part numbers. Any BOM with specific part numbers is going to need to be edited before it can really be used, as part numbers change and no two people are going to have exactly the same idea about what parts should go into the amp. The idea was just to make a complete list of everything required according to that schematic.
